Origins and Family
Born in Amman[2], Nasser Judeh… he was born on July 11, 1961[3].
Education
Educated at Georgetown University[9], a private university[21], in United States[22], founded in 1789[23], headquartered in Washington, D.C.[24] and Eastbourne College[10], a boarding school[25], in United Kingdom[26], founded in 1867[27].
Career and Affiliations
Nasser Judeh worked as a politician[4]. He held the position of Minister of Foreign Affairs of Jordan[8].
Personal Life
Nasser Judeh was married to Princess Sumaya bint El Hassan of Jordan[6].
